Salary of History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$37,218 Bachelor's Median Salary

History students who finish a bachelor’s at Utah State University report a median salary of $37,218 a year. This is below $48,041, the median for all majors at Utah State University.

Student Debt of History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$25,237 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Utah State University, history graduates take on a median debt of $25,237 in student loans. This is above $16,142, the typical median for all majors at Utah State University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 47% of history bachelor’s degrees went to men and 53% went to women.

Utah State University gender breakdown of History Bachelor's degree grads The majority of history bachelor’s degree graduates at Utah State University are White. About 98% of graduates fell into this category.
